Cannot install monitor drivers   
Monitor is Benq LCD.

When I try to install the drivers....

Monitor > Default monitor > properties is greyed out

Adapter > properties > Vga Save

I click driver  then current status is 'started' then nothing happens.

Very few times does one actually *need* the monitor drivers.  What is needed 
is the video card drivers.

What video card do you have?

Unsure?  Download, installa nd allow to run "Belarc Advisor" and check out 
its report.  If everything is setup properly (someone installed this system 
correctly) you will see what your video card (display adapter) is and then 
figure out where to get the latest hardware drivers for it.

Quick fix:
1.  Locate or download drivers to a known folder.
2.  In / Control Panel / System / Device Manager
wholly remove monitor(s) and reboot.
3.  At reboot, the system will recognize the monitor
as "new" and prompt you to approve installing drivers.
If necessary, point the system to the folder name
noted in #1.
